Waratahs coach Daryl Gibson has included Cameron Clark and Nick Phipps back into the starting XV to face the Crusaders on Saturday night. Meanwhile, Karmichael Hunt will come off the bench since recovering from a hamstring injury.
Waratahs youngster Lachlan Swinton is yet to play against the Crusaders, but says if he gets his chance on Saturday night he'll be ready for an upfront battle. Meanwhile, the SCG has been given the all clear to host the clash for round six.

The Reds are going with their more experienced players to face the Crusaders on Saturday night. Injured duo Scott Higginbotham and JP Smith return from the bench, while Lukhan Salakaia-Loto shifts to flanker and Angus Scott-Young will start at No.8 .
